package org.pentaho.di.trans.steps.sasinput;
import java.util.Arrays;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import java.util.Random;
import java.util.UUID;
import org.apache.commons.lang.builder.EqualsBuilder;
import org.junit.Before;
import org.junit.Test;
import org.pentaho.di.core.KettleEnvironment;
import org.pentaho.di.core.exception.KettleException;
import org.pentaho.di.core.plugins.PluginRegistry;
import org.pentaho.di.trans.steps.loadsave.LoadSaveTester;
import org.pentaho.di.trans.steps.loadsave.validator.FieldLoadSaveValidator;
import org.pentaho.di.trans.steps.loadsave.validator.ListLoadSaveValidator;
public class SasInputMetaTest {
LoadSaveTester loadSaveTester;
Class<SasInputMeta> testMetaClass = SasInputMeta.class;
@Before
public void setUpLoadSave() throws Exception {
KettleEnvironment.init();
PluginRegistry.init( true );
List<String> attributes =
Arrays.asList( "acceptingField", "outputFields" );
Map<String, String> gsMap = new HashMap<String, String>();
Map<String, FieldLoadSaveValidator<?>> attrValidatorMap = new HashMap<String, FieldLoadSaveValidator<?>>();
attrValidatorMap.put( "outputFields",
new ListLoadSaveValidator<SasInputField>( new SasInputFieldLoadSaveValidator(), 5 ) );
Map<String, FieldLoadSaveValidator<?>> typeValidatorMap = new HashMap<String, FieldLoadSaveValidator<?>>();
loadSaveTester =
new LoadSaveTester( testMetaClass, attributes, gsMap, gsMap, attrValidatorMap, typeValidatorMap );
}
@Test
public void testSerialization() throws KettleException {
loadSaveTester.testSerialization();
}
public class SasInputFieldLoadSaveValidator implements FieldLoadSaveValidator<SasInputField> {
final Random rand = new Random();
@Override
public SasInputField getTestObject() {
SasInputField rtn = new SasInputField();
rtn.setRename( UUID.randomUUID().toString() );
rtn.setDecimalSymbol( UUID.randomUUID().toString() );
rtn.setConversionMask( UUID.randomUUID().toString() );
rtn.setGroupingSymbol( UUID.randomUUID().toString() );
rtn.setName( UUID.randomUUID().toString() );
rtn.setTrimType( rand.nextInt( 4 ) );
rtn.setPrecision( rand.nextInt( 9 ) );
rtn.setType( rand.nextInt( 7 ) );
rtn.setLength( rand.nextInt( 50 ) );
return rtn;
}
@Override
public boolean validateTestObject( SasInputField testObject, Object actual ) {
if ( !( actual instanceof SasInputField ) ) {
return false;
}
SasInputField another = (SasInputField) actual;
return new EqualsBuilder()
.append( testObject.getName(), another.getName() )
.append( testObject.getTrimType(), another.getTrimType() )
.append( testObject.getType(), another.getType() )
.append( testObject.getPrecision(), another.getPrecision() )
.append( testObject.getRename(), another.getRename() )
.append( testObject.getDecimalSymbol(), another.getDecimalSymbol() )
.append( testObject.getConversionMask(), another.getConversionMask() )
.append( testObject.getGroupingSymbol(), another.getGroupingSymbol() )
.append( testObject.getLength(), another.getLength() )
.isEquals();
}
}
}
